True. It's dual licensed. Most of the features are available in the self hosted / local version.


It's dual licensed in a way, but neither license is open source. The OSI messed up in not coming up with an answer to the SSPL, and now ambitious projects that would have traditionally gone with an open source license like AGPL are now foregoing open source entirely and just slapping a sustainable use license on it.

So yeah, you can use n8n for free, but that doesn't make it open source. It is a source available license.
